Project 17 is a small organisation working to end homelessness and severe poverty among migrants with no recourse to public funds (NRPF). We are expanding our area of specialism to include support for people with care needs who are subject to NRPF.

We are recruiting a Care Act Supervisor to lead this work. The postholder will oversee the development of Project 17's Care Act work, including the recruitment and induction of additional team members.

The postholder will manage a caseload working with adults in need of support under the Care Act 2014 and families in need of support under s.17 Children Act 1989.
